Session: Returns and the Index World

Historical returns are frequently used in financial plans, in illustrations for insurance products, and in the presentation of investment strategies. But projecting history forward presents significant challenges. Laurence Black, Founder of the Index Standard®, index advisor to Dr. Robert Shiller and former Head of Quantitative Indices at Barclays explains why the past is prologue to the future, how today's indices are dramatically different than the indices of the past, and how advisors can think about asset classes and indices in the context of their planning process.

Joe Elsasser, CFP®
Sessions: Social Security and Tax Updates | EMR Planning Meeting Processes

Joe Elsasser is the Founder and President of Covisum and also a practicing advisor. He created Social Security Timing® in 2010. Covisum was founded in 2016 to reflect the company's expansion into a broader array of key retirement income decisions, with the launches of Tax Clarity® in 2016, SmartRisk™ in 2018, and most recently, Income InSight®. These tools are all based on streamlining or systematizing processes used in Joe's own planning practice and the practices of other advisors Covisum serves.
